Adding custom item to toolbar in EJ2 JavaScript File manager control

You can modify the items displayed in the toolbar by utilizing the toolbarItems API. To display both default and customized items, it’s essential to assign a unique name to each item. Additionally, you have the flexibility to alter the default items by adjusting properties such as tooltipText, iconCss, Text, suffixIcon and more. This level of customization allows you to tailor the toolbar to your specific requirements and design preferences. The names used in the code example below serve as unique identifiers for default toolbar items, while custom items can be assigned any unique name value to distinguish them from the defaults.

For instance, here’s an example of how to add a custom checkbox to the toolbar using the template property. Here we have modified the default New Folder item and added a custom toolbar item for selection.

var hostUrl = 'https://ej2-aspcore-service.azurewebsites.net/';
// inject feature modules of the file manager
ej.filemanager.FileManager.Inject(ej.filemanager.DetailsView,ej.filemanager.Toolbar,ej.filemanager.NavigationPane);
// initialize File Manager component
var filemanagerInstance = new ej.filemanager.FileManager({
    ajaxSettings: {
        url: hostUrl + 'api/FileManager/FileOperations',
        getImageUrl: hostUrl + 'api/FileManager/GetImage',
        uploadUrl: hostUrl + 'api/FileManager/Upload',
        downloadUrl: hostUrl + 'api/FileManager/Download'
    },
    //Custom item added along with default item
    toolbarItems: [{ text: 'Create folder' , name: 'NewFolder', prefixIcon: 'e-plus', tooltipText: 'Create folder' }, 
    { name: 'Upload' },   
    { name: 'SortBy' },
    { name: 'Refresh' },
    { name: 'Cut' },
    { name: 'Copy' },
    { name: 'Paste' },
    { name: 'Delete' },
    { name: 'Download' },
    { name: 'Rename' },
    { template: '<input id="checkbox" type="checkbox"/>', name: 'Select' },
    { name: 'Selection' },
    { name: 'View' },
    { name: 'Details' }]
});

// render initialized File Manager
filemanagerInstance.appendTo('#filemanager');

// Render Checkbox in template
var checkbox = new ej.buttons.CheckBox({ label: 'Select All', checked: false, change: onChange },'#checkbox');

// on checkbox change select all or clear selection
function onChange(args) {
    if (args.checked) {
        filemanagerInstance.selectAll(); 
        checkbox.label = 'Unselect All';
    }
    else {
        filemanagerInstance.clearSelection();
        checkbox.label = 'Select All';
    }
}
